The Lodge is a carousel of revolving decór and clothes. Spun around the concept of nomadic chic, the store pawns everything from the sundry items on its shelves to its couches, leaving the impression of a giant close-out sale. Clothes are even flung into flight trunks, the most popular non-clothing sale items.

Thankfully, business is firmly rooted on 24 rue de Poitou. Owners Ema and Hugo envision themselves as “incubators” of new or small labels uncommon in Paris, like handbags from Canadian leather geniuses M0851, jewelry from Belgium label Chine and French designer Annabel Winship.

Meanwhile, in-house label Maison Kahut—designed around the fictional adventures of a modern princess—borrows heavily from history, yielding such items as a Victorian-silhouette jacket festooned with 19th-century-inspired buttons. Despite the transient concept, the Lodge and Maison Kahut are here to stay.
